Человек-Паук — один из самых популярных супергероев комиксов Marvel. Его невероятные способности и характерный костюм покорили сердца миллионов фанатов по всему миру. И если вы также являетесь его поклонником и мечтаете создать свою собственную игру, вы попали по адресу!
В этом самоучителе мы научимся создавать веб-шутер с Человеком-Пауком в главной роли. Вы научитесь создавать трехмерный мир, устанавливать правила игры, а также добавлять различные возможности для вашего героя. По мере продвижения в самоучителе вы будете улучшать свои навыки программирования и станете настоящим супергероем в создании игр.
Важно отметить, что для прохождения этого самоучителя вам потребуется знание основ веб-разработки и программирования на JavaScript. Но не волнуйтесь, если вы новичок в этой области, мы предоставим вам все необходимые инструкции и объяснения для успешного освоения материала.
Создание веб-шутера: самоучитель
Прежде всего, вы должны определиться с языком программирования, который вы будете использовать для создания веб-шутера. Для создания веб-игр часто используется JavaScript, так как он является одним из самых популярных и широко используемых языков программирования для веб-разработки. Вы также можете использовать HTML5 и CSS для создания пользовательского интерфейса и визуализации игры.
После выбора языка программирования вам следует определиться со структурой игры. Подумайте о том, какие элементы будут присутствовать в вашем веб-шутере: окружение, оружие, персонажи, противники и т.д. Рассмотрите также механику игры: какие действия сможет выполнять игрок, какие будут правила игры и цели.
Далее вы можете приступить к разработке игрового движка. Игровой движок — это основа вашей игры, который будет отвечать за отображение графики, обработку пользовательского ввода, управление объектами и многие другие аспекты игры. Вы можете использовать готовые игровые движки, такие как Phaser или Three.js, или создать свой собственный с нуля.
После создания игрового движка вам следует приступить к разработке графики и анимаций для вашего веб-шутера. Вы можете использовать графические редакторы, такие как Photoshop или Illustrator, для создания текстур, спрайтов и других графических элементов игры. Анимации можно создать с помощью специальных программ, таких как Spine или Spriter.
Когда графика и анимации готовы, вы можете приступить к разработке игровой логики и созданию уровней. Определите, как игрок будет взаимодействовать с окружающим миром, какие действия будут доступны, какие задачи нужно выполнить.
Наконец, вы можете приступить к тестированию и отладке вашего веб-шутера. Проверьте, работает ли игра правильно, нет ли ошибок или багов, проверьте производительность и оптимизируйте игру при необходимости.
Теперь у вас есть все необходимые инструменты и знания для создания своего собственного веб-шутера. Удачи в разработке и не забывайте воплощать свои самые смелые идеи!
Участвуйте в захватывающих приключениях Питера Паркера, воплощая Человека-Паука
Создайте невероятный мир Человека-Паука с помощью нашего самоучителя по созданию веб-шутера. Вам предстоит окунуться в захватывающую историю Питера Паркера и стать настоящим героем.
В этом проекте вы научитесь создавать интерактивный веб-шутер, в котором ваш персонаж будет передвигаться по городским джунглям, сражаться с преступниками и спасать мир от зла. Ваш Человек-Паук будет владеть особыми способностями, такими как высокие прыжки и стрельба паутиной.
Вы будете использовать HTML, CSS и JavaScript, чтобы создать анимацию движения героя и врагов, а также добавить звуки и эффекты, чтобы сделать игру еще более реалистичной. Весь процесс разработки будет пошагово объяснен в нашем самоучителе, что позволит вам легко погрузиться в мир создания игр.
Наш самоучитель исключительно практический, поэтому вы сможете сразу практиковать полученные знания и наблюдать результаты. Вы также сможете настраивать и улучшать игру по своему вкусу, делая ее уникальной и интересной.
Будьте готовы к захватывающим приключениям вместе с Питером Паркером и его невероятными способностями. Участвуйте в создании веб-шутера и станьте настоящим Человеком-Пауком.
Шаг 1: Подготовка и настройка окружения для разработки
Перед тем, как приступить к созданию нашего веб-шутера с Человеком-Пауком, необходимо подготовить и настроить окружение для разработки. В этом шаге мы рассмотрим несколько ключевых действий, которые помогут нам в этой задаче.
Шаг | Действие |
1 | Установите актуальную версию браузера, такую как Google Chrome или Mozilla Firefox. Они предоставляют современные инструменты разработчика и поддерживают последние стандарты веб-технологий. |
2 | Установите текстовый редактор для работы с кодом. Вы можете выбрать любой редактор, с которым вы комфортно работаете, например, Visual Studio Code или Sublime Text. |
3 | Установите локальный веб-сервер, чтобы иметь возможность запускать и тестировать свой проект локально. Рекомендуется использовать сервер Apache, либо любой другой сервер, который вы предпочитаете. |
После выполнения всех вышеперечисленных действий, вы будете готовы приступить к созданию веб-шутера с Человеком-Пауком. В следующих шагах мы рассмотрим основы разработки игр, а также настройку графики и управления. Удачной работы!
Шаг 2: Реализация движения и физики Паука
После того, как мы создали основу для нашего веб-шутера и добавили изображение Человека-Паука, важно реализовать движение и физику героя.
Движение Паука будет основано на нажатии клавиш на клавиатуре. Мы будем использовать JavaScript для обработки событий нажатия клавиш. Когда пользователь нажимает клавишу влево, Паук будет двигаться влево, и наоборот.
Для реализации движения мы будем использовать CSS свойства transform и animation. Transform позволяет нам изменять положение и размер элемента, а animation позволяет создавать анимацию движения.
Также важно учесть физику движения Паука. Мы хотим, чтобы Паук мог скакать и приземляться на землю. Для этого мы будем использовать гравитацию и ускорение. При нажатии клавиши прыжка, мы будем добавлять ускорение вверх, и затем учитывать гравитацию, чтобы Паук вернулся на землю.
Реализация движения и физики Паука требует внимательности и точности. Мы должны рассчитать правильные значения для ускорения и гравитации, чтобы движение выглядело естественно и плавно.
В следующем шаге мы реализуем движение Паука и его физику с помощью JavaScript и CSS свойств. Готовьтесь к захватывающим приключениям вместе с Человеком-Пауком!
Шаг 3: Создание врагов и сражений с ними
Теперь, когда мы создали нашего героя Человека-Паука, настало время добавить в игру врагов, с которыми он будет сражаться.
Для создания врагов мы будем использовать элементы HTML и CSS. Каждому врагу мы присвоим уникальный идентификатор (ID) и зададим ему отдельные стили.
Начнем с создания списка врагов:
- Враг 1
- Враг 2
- Враг 3
Теперь давайте добавим стили для врагов:
Вы можете выбрать любые стили для врагов, которые соответствуют вашей концепции игры. Например, вы можете задать им разные фоновые цвета, размеры и расположение.
Чтобы сделать врагов интерактивными, добавим JavaScript-код, который будет обрабатывать сражение с ними:
let enemies = document.querySelectorAll('.enemy'); enemies.forEach(enemy => { enemy.addEventListener('click', () => { // Код для обработки сражения с врагом }); });
Теперь, когда у нас есть список врагов и обработчики сражений, мы готовы к следующему шагу — созданию логики игры, в которой игрок сможет сражаться с врагами и побеждать или проигрывать.